/blockaid only works with players outside your party, which cant really be applied to Warp II, since it's a party-only spell in the first place.

and I'm sure /blockaid was a preventaive measure against claim stealing... since it was (and in some cases, still is) a popular tactic for a Paladin to spam Cure spells on a party fighting an NM to put himself on the mob's hate list, then putting up Invincible and using /ja's until he had stolen hate and claimed, or at the very least, allowed the mob to go unclaimed so that members of his party could act on it.

Was pretty common to see back in the days before /blockaid for a PLD to use this tactic at Fafnir to cause a spike flail.. was awesome when you got to MPK an enitre rival alliance lol
